Minor styling revisions and new features mark the 2004 LS 430. Lexus flagship sedan retains a 4.3-liter V8, but swaps a 5-speed automatic transmission for a 6-speed with manual shift gate. Antiskid/traction control remains standard. An available Sport Package bundles a firmer Euro-Tuned Suspension with new 18-inch wheels to replace standard 17s. Standard driver and front-passenger knee airbags join head-protecting curtain side airbags and larger front torso side airbags. Also added are tire-pressure monitor, steering-linked headlights, and power rear sunshade. New options include heated/cooled rear seats and a rearview TV camera that uses the available navigation systems screen when backing up. Also newly optional is Lexus SmartAccess keyless entry/starting system with pocket transmitter. Satellite radio is a new dealer-installed option.
